TUFTS University Fall Events

 Fall for Tufts

Fall for Tufts includes (among many other events) mock classes, a portfolio workshop for artists applying to the School of the Museum of Fine Arts, an opportunity to learn how the Career Center supports students as they seek out internships, graduate school placement, and careers, and a QuestBridge Scholar panel.
